Door and window repair services involve fixing issues that affect the functionality, appearance, and security of existing doors and windows in a property. This can include repairing broken or cracked glass, fixing damaged frames, realigning misaligned doors or windows, and addressing problems with locks, hinges, or handles. These services help restore the proper operation of doors and windows, ensuring they open and close smoothly, provide security, and maintain the overall integrity of the property.
Many common problems lead homeowners to seek door and window repair services. These include drafts or air leaks caused by damaged seals or warped frames, broken glass panes that compromise safety and insulation, and malfunctioning hardware that prevents proper locking or opening. Additionally, signs of wear and tear such as cracked frames, swollen wood, or hinges that no longer function properly can diminish the security and energy efficiency of a home. Repairing these issues can prevent further damage and help maintain the property's value.

The overview below groups typical Door Window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in San Diego, CA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or fixes such as replacing a broken window pane or repairing a loose frame generally range from $150 to $400. Many routine repairs fall within this middle band, depending on the extent of the damage and materials used.
Standard Window Replacements - Replacing a standard-sized door or window usually costs between $500 and $1,500. Most projects in this category are straightforward and tend to stay within this range, though larger or more complex installations can cost more.
Custom or Specialty Installations - Custom-sized or specialty windows, including energy-efficient or decorative styles, often range from $1,500 to $3,500. Fewer projects reach into this higher tier, which reflects added materials and installation complexity.
Full Door or Window Replacements - Larger, more comprehensive projects, such as replacing multiple windows or entire door systems, can range from $2,500 to $5,000 or more. These tend to be less common but are necessary for extensive upgrades or structural changes.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
